超越关系型数据库:MongoDB 和文档数据库革命

Discuss hot database and enhance operational efficiency together.
Post Reply
Noyonhasan630
Posts: 101
Joined: Thu May 22, 2025 5:13 am

超越关系型数据库:MongoDB 和文档数据库革命

Post by Noyonhasan630 »

传统关系数据库僵化的预定义模式虽然非常适合结构化数据并严格遵循 ACID 规范,但面对快速发展的数据模型以及非结构化和半结构化数据的爆炸式增长,它已日益成为瓶颈。在这样的格局下,MongoDB 已成为 2025 年的领军者,引领文档数据库革命。作为 NoSQL 数据库,MongoDB 将数据存储在灵活的 JSON 格式文档中,为现代应用程序提供无与伦比的敏捷性和可扩展性。这种无模式特性使开发人员能够快速迭代,轻松适应数据结构的变化,而无需进行昂贵且耗时的迁移。

MongoDB 的根本优势在于其面向文档的方法。每条记录都是一个文档,文档可以包含嵌入式文档和数组,从而允许将复杂的层次结构数据存储在单个逻辑单元中。这消除了对大量表连接(关系数据库中常见的性能开销)的需要,并且通常可以实现更直观的数据建模,与面向对象的编程范式紧密相关。对于处理各种数据类型的应用程序(从具有不同属性的用户资料到 圭亚那 viber 数据 具有嵌套规范的产品目录),MongoDB 提供了一种自然而高效的方式来存储和查询这些信息。其丰富的查询语言——MongoDB 查询语言 (MQL)——提供了强大的数据查询、聚合和分析功能,通常可以简化复杂的数据检索操作。

水平扩展性是 MongoDB 稳居 2025 年顶级专用数据库之列的另一项核心优势。通过分片技术,MongoDB 可以将大型数据集分布到多个服务器或集群中,从而随着数据量的增长实现无缝扩展。这种分布式架构不仅可以处理海量数据,还能提供高可用性和容错能力,确保应用程序即使在硬件故障的情况下也能保持响应。这种能力对于大规模 Web 应用程序、物联网平台和大数据分析尤为重要,因为这些领域的数据提取率和查询量可能难以预测且规模巨大。许多领先的公司将 MongoDB 用于其核心服务,从内容管理系统到移动后端,受益于其灵活性和处理高流量的能力。
Post Reply